In Algeria, the industrial landscape is heavily dominated by oil, gas, and phosphate mining. These sectors operate in environments characterized by intense UV radiation and high thermal oscillation between day and night, making traditional steel infrastructure susceptible to rapid corrosion. The adoption of an FRP Tank has become essential for storing aggressive chemicals without the risk of oxidation common in the coastal regions of Algiers and Oran.
Furthermore, the scarcity of freshwater resources in the southern regions has driven a surge in desalination projects. These plants require highly resistant FRP Pipe networks to handle brine and chlorinated water, where metal piping would fail within a few years. This transition reflects a shift toward materials that offer a lower total cost of ownership over a 20-year lifecycle.
Despite the demand, many local facilities still rely on outdated composite techniques. There is a growing market gap for an FRP Customized Product that can be precisely engineered to meet the specific pressure and temperature ratings required by the Algerian Ministry of Energy and Mines standards.
